La programmation

Q & A pour les programmeurs professionnels et passionnés



8
Comment puis-je formater ma sortie grep pour afficher les numéros de ligne à la fin de la ligne, ainsi que le nombre de résultats?
J'utilise grep pour faire correspondre la chaîne dans un fichier. Voici un exemple de fichier: example one, example two null, example three, example four null, grep -i null myfile.txt Retour example two null, example four null, Comment puis-je renvoyer les lignes correspondantes avec leurs numéros de ligne comme ceci: example …
378 linux  bash  unix  grep 

13
Comment lier des propriétés booléennes inverses dans WPF?
Ce que j'ai, c'est un objet qui a une IsReadOnlypropriété. Si cette propriété est vraie, je voudrais définir la IsEnabledpropriété d'un bouton (par exemple) sur false. Je voudrais croire que je peux le faire aussi facilement que cela, IsEnabled="{Binding Path=!IsReadOnly}"mais cela ne fonctionne pas avec WPF. Suis-je relégué à devoir …
378 wpf  .net-3.5  styles 


13
Comment écrire en ligne si une déclaration à imprimer?
J'ai besoin d'imprimer certaines choses uniquement lorsqu'une variable booléenne est définie sur True. Donc, après avoir regardé cela , j'ai essayé avec un exemple simple: >>> a = 100 >>> b = True >>> print a if b File "<stdin>", line 1 print a if b ^ SyntaxError: invalid syntax …





4
En-têtes personnalisés PHP cURL
Je me demande si / comment vous pouvez ajouter des en-têtes personnalisés à une requête HTTP cURL en PHP. J'essaie d'imiter la façon dont iTunes récupère les illustrations et utilise ces en-têtes non standard: X-Apple-Tz: 0 X-Apple-Store-Front: 143444,12 Comment puis-je ajouter ces en-têtes à une demande?
378 php  curl 


8
Quelle est la différence entre `throw new Error` et` throw someObject`?
Je veux écrire un gestionnaire d'erreurs commun qui capturera volontairement les erreurs personnalisées sur n'importe quelle instance du code. Quand j'ai throw new Error('sample')aimé dans le code suivant try { throw new Error({'hehe':'haha'}); // throw new Error('hehe'); } catch(e) { alert(e); console.log(e); } Le journal s'affiche dans Firefox as Error: …



En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.